Mount Epomeo
Volcano Volcanic summit of Ischia island, island's highest point
Rising on Ischia off Naples, Mount Epomeo is reached by mule tracks and footpaths from hilltop villages. Tourists hike through vineyards and eucalyptus groves for wide views over the Bay of Naples.
Mount Epomeo is the highest point on the island of Ischia in the Tyrrhenian Sea off the coast of Naples, Campania, with a summit at about 789 metres. It is a volcanic uplift that dominates the island’s central ridge.
Trails and narrow roads reach the upper slopes and summit area; hikes typically take a few hours from nearby villages and offer panoramic views across the Bay of Naples and the surrounding islands. The slopes are dotted with small villages and agricultural terraces.
The mountain is volcanic in origin and forms the central spine of Ischia; its geology and topography reflect the island’s volcanic history. Over time the summit and slopes have been used for small-scale farming, settlement, and seasonal grazing.
Epomeo occupies central Ischia, rising above the island’s towns and vineyards and overlooking the Bay of Naples to the east and south.
- Elevation: Highest point on the island of Ischia at 789 metres.

How to Get to Mount Epomeo #
Mount Epomeo sits at the center of Ischia island (Gulf of Naples). To reach Ischia, take a ferry or hydrofoil from Naples (Molo Beverello or Calata Porta di Massa) to Ischia Porto. From Ischia Porto you can take local buses or a taxi toward the villages of Fontana/Serrara (the island bus network serves these villages); from the village of Fontana a well-marked footpath and local tracks lead up to the summit (the final approach is a short uphill walk from the village road).
There is no rail service to Ischia; all mainland connections are by ferry/hydrofoil from Naples, Pozzuoli or Sorrento. On the island itself, buses and taxis connect Ischia Porto with the trailhead villages.
Tips for Visiting Mount Epomeo #
- Aim for a morning ascent when visibility is clearest and temperatures are cooler - the summit is Ischia's highest point and early light gives the best panoramic views across the Tyrrhenian Sea and the Bay of Naples.
- The climb is relatively short compared with mainland peaks, so avoid the busiest hours (late afternoon on summer weekends) by starting midweek or at first light to have the ridge largely to yourself.
- Stick to the marked paths to the summit viewpoint - many visitors pass through on day trips from the island's towns, so combine the hike with a quieter arrival or departure time on the ferry to dodge peak tourist traffic.
Best Time to Visit Mount Epomeo #
Best visited spring or autumn to avoid summer crowds and high heat while still enjoying clear views and hiking.
